Using Twitter for Research
This session will cover the basic principles of the microblogging platform Twitter. Participants will have the opportunity to get to grips with using Twitter and understanding the platform’s unique community and language through hands-on activities. Aspects of science communication will be touched upon as well as examples of best practice, using Twitter personally and professionally, before concluding with some top tips on getting the most out of this communication tool.

Participants will be able to create engaging Twitter content in line with their individual goals
Participants will be able to evaluate and determine which aspects of the Twitter platform can benefit them and their work
Participants will be able to use tools and best practice to maximise their engagement with Twitter
